I learned that through trial and error. Mostly error. And a lot of not catching flounders until I figured it out.Flounder are ambush predators. They stay hid till something comes by in range, then they strike. If you want to catch them regular, keep your bait moving, and close to the bottom. An old local taught me that over 50 years ago.
